The 2014 US Olympic Freestyle Ski Team was renowned for its rigorous training regimen that prepared athletes for the demanding Olympic competitions in Sochi, Russia. Their success was the result of intense physical preparation, technical skill development, and mental conditioning.
Physical Training and Conditioning
Athletes engaged in daily strength and endurance workouts to build the power necessary for complex aerial maneuvers and high-speed skiing. Their training included weightlifting, cardiovascular exercises, and agility drills tailored to enhance explosive strength and stamina.
Strength Training
Strength training focused on core stability, leg strength, and upper body power. Exercises such as squats, deadlifts, and plyometrics were common to improve jump height and control during aerial tricks.
Endurance and Flexibility
Endurance was developed through long-distance running, cycling, and interval training. Flexibility routines, including yoga and stretching, helped prevent injuries and increased range of motion for complex maneuvers.
Technical Skill Development
Training sessions emphasized perfecting aerial tricks, spins, and flips. Athletes practiced on specialized trampolines, foam pits, and in simulated snow conditions to hone their skills safely and effectively.
Video Analysis and Feedback
Video analysis played a crucial role, allowing athletes and coaches to review performances frame-by-frame. This feedback helped refine technique and correct errors in real-time.
On-Snow Practice
Regular on-snow training was vital. Athletes trained on various terrain parks, practicing jumps, rails, and moguls to adapt to different snow conditions and improve consistency.
Mental Conditioning
Mental toughness was developed through visualization, meditation, and working with sports psychologists. This helped athletes manage pressure, stay focused, and recover quickly from setbacks.
Visualization Techniques
Visualizing successful runs and routines helped athletes build confidence and reduce anxiety before competitions.
Stress Management
Breathing exercises and mindfulness practices were integrated into daily routines to help athletes stay calm and focused during high-stakes events.
The comprehensive training regimen of the 2014 US Olympic Freestyle Ski Team combined physical, technical, and mental preparation. This holistic approach was key to their success and serves as a model for future Olympic athletes.
